One Thing I’m Watching: The AI-Fication of the S&P 500

When the S&P 500 was introduced nearly 70 years ago, it was designed to represent a wide swath of the U.S. economy. Call it the AI-fication of the S&P 500, in which a handful of companies now exert outsize influence over the benchmark index. According to Dow Jones Market Data, the 10 largest companies in the S&P 500 now represent 43.2% of the index's total market value.

The ‘AI Train’ Moves Ahead
The Wall Street Journal66d agoneutral
The ‘AI Train’ Moves Ahead

The S&P 500 just posted one of its best two-month runs ever. That often means more good times ahead. Chip stocks powered the S&P up 16% across April and May, a two-month surge matched only four other times since 1950, according to Dow Jones Market Data.
